Head for Oughterard, Galway, and fish the mighty Corrib. Thats the prime time for the welshmans button. There is a newly built hotel in the town and no shortage of guillies. Top class dry sedge action.

I live in co cork quite close to ballyhass lakes which was mentioned above and fish it alot.It holds a number of double figure fish.but average is around 3 to 4 pound.The big ones are norm caught down deep on lures.I would highly recommend halls holiday homes on the shores of lough mask.It cost around 400euro a week but worth every penny.The fishing is fantastic but you may need a guide if you wish to go any distance on the lake.Its not called the mighty mask for nothing.Hope this helps.
